Unveiling the SEO Trinity

SEO encompasses three core pillars, each playing a vital role in your overall strategy:

  1. On-Page SEO: This is where you optimize the elements within your website. Think of it as decorating your digital storefront to attract and engage customers.

    • Keyword Optimization: Strategically incorporating relevant keywords (like those you identified through keyword research) into your content helps search engines understand what your page is about.
    • Content Quality: High-quality, informative content that aligns with user intent is king in the SEO realm.
    • Technical SEO: Ensuring your website is technically sound, with fast loading times, mobile responsiveness, and clean code.
  2. Off-Page SEO: This pillar focuses on building your website’s authority and reputation outside of its own domain.

    • Backlinks: Earning high-quality backlinks from other reputable websites signals to search engines that your content is valuable.
    • Social Signals: Social media engagement can indirectly influence your SEO rankings.
    • Brand Mentions: Positive mentions of your brand across the web contribute to your online authority.
  3. Technical SEO: While often overlooked, technical SEO is the backbone of your optimization efforts.

    • Site Speed: A slow-loading website frustrates users and hurts your rankings.
    • Mobile-Friendliness: With mobile usage surpassing desktop, ensuring your site is responsive is crucial.
    • Crawling and Indexing: Making sure search engines can easily crawl and index your website’s pages.
    • Structured Data: Implementing structured data (schema markup) helps search engines better understand your content.

Mapping Out Your SEO Journey

Creating an effective SEO strategy involves a holistic approach that leverages all three pillars. Here’s a roadmap to guide you:

  1. Keyword Research: Identify the keywords your target audience uses to search for information related to your niche.
  2. On-Page Optimization: Craft compelling titles, meta descriptions, and header tags that incorporate your target keywords naturally.
  3. Content Creation: Produce high-quality, engaging content that provides value to your readers and aligns with their search intent.
  4. Technical Audit: Conduct a technical audit to identify and fix any issues that hinder your website’s performance.
  5. Link Building: Build a network of high-quality backlinks through guest posting, outreach, and content promotion.
  6. Monitor and Adapt: Regularly monitor your SEO performance, track your rankings, and adjust your strategy as needed.
